On June 18, Redington Limited experienced a notable increase in its stock value, reaching a peak of Rs 264.80 on the NSE. The rise was driven by recent reports about Apple's rising prices, which sparked excitement among investors.
Apple CEO Tim Cook's comments about future price hikes added momentum to the market. Analysts noted that this development reflects growing interest in Apple products.
The Indian stock market saw a spike as traders reacted to these updates.
